Identify Online Snapshots Using the NimbleOS GUI
You can use the NimbleOS GUI to identify snapshots that are currently online.
Procedure
- Select .
- Select the volume that might have an online snapshot.
- Click the Snapshots tab. Online snapshots show up as green.
- Determine whether the online snapshot is connected to a host (initiator). If a host is actively using the snapshot, complete the operation that is in progress; for example migrating or moving data.
-
Determine whether there is a reason to have the online snapshot in the
future:
- Is the snapshot required by an application or script. If it is, take the
following actions:
- Check the retention schedule to make sure the snapshot will be removed at a future date.
- Disconnect the snapshot from the host before the next snapshot deletion operation is scheduled to occur.
- Is this the only common snapshot between the upstream array and the downstream array. If it is, then deleting the snapshot would cause the volume to need a full re-seed.

If you do not need to maintain an online snapshot, perform the following
steps:
- Disconnect the snapshot from the host.
- Make it offline.
- Delete it.
